Understanding the Car Rental Market in 2025
As consumer behavior shifts toward digital-first experiences, the online car rental market is flourishing. Key factors driving this growth include:
- Increased Urbanization: More people are living in cities where owning a car is less practical, making rental services appealing.
- Sustainability Focus: Shared mobility models align with global efforts to reduce carbon footprints.
- Technological Advancements: AI, machine learning, and blockchain are transforming the user experience and operational efficiency.
- Peer-to-Peer Platforms: Platforms like Turo have demonstrated the profitability of peer-to-peer (P2P) car rental models.

Challenges and How to Overcome Them
While the car rental business offers lucrative opportunities, it also comes with challenges:
- High Competition: Differentiate yourself with unique offerings and exceptional service.
- Regulatory Compliance: Stay updated on local regulations regarding vehicle rentals.
- Maintenance Costs: Implement efficient maintenance and inspection processes for listed vehicles.
- User Trust: Build trust through secure transactions, verified listings, and responsive customer support.
Future Trends to Watch in the Car Rental Industry
1. Subscription-Based Models
Platforms may offer subscription services, allowing users unlimited access to certain vehicles for a monthly fee.
2. Autonomous Vehicles
As self-driving cars become mainstream, integrating them into your fleet could be a game-changer.
3. Augmented Reality (AR)
Use AR for virtual vehicle tours, enhancing the booking experience.
4. Hyper-Personalization
AI-driven personalization will enable businesses to offer highly customized recommendations.
